CVE-2017-15333 : Security Advisory and Response

Learn about CVE-2017-15333 affecting Huawei S series switches and eCNS210_TD. Discover the impact, affected systems, exploitation method, and mitigation steps.

Huawei Technologies Co., Ltd. has reported a vulnerability affecting multiple products in their S series switches and eCNS210_TD. The vulnerability allows attackers to launch denial of service (DOS) attacks by exploiting specific XML files.

Vulnerability Description

The vulnerability lies in the XML parser of Huawei S series switches and eCNS210_TD, enabling attackers to trigger DOS attacks.

Affected Systems and Versions

        Products: S12700, S1700, S3700, S5700, S6700, S7700, S9700, eCNS210_TD
        Versions: Various versions of the mentioned products are affected.

Exploitation Mechanism

Attackers can craft specific XML files tailored to the affected products, exploiting the XML parser vulnerability to execute DOS attacks.
